Floyd Road Solar Farm is a 5 MW solar photovoltaic power plant located in Northampton County, North Carolina. The plant began operating in 2017 and has a single generator. It is owned and operated by Greenbacker Renewable Energy Corporation. The plant utilizes single-axis tracking to maximize solar energy capture.
The facility's latest annual generation was 9,181 MWh, resulting in a capacity factor of 20.9%. Floyd Road Solar Farm is interconnected to the grid within the PJM Interconnection, LLC balancing authority and the SERC NERC region. The plant ranks 288th in size among solar facilities in North Carolina (out of 770) and 2257th nationally (out of 7108).
